### Account Recovery — Catalogue Import (Lintwood)

Quick one for review: when the Lintwood catalogue import wipes a patron's session table, the recovery flow re-seeds accounts from the nightly snapshot. Check that the importer skips locked accounts — last time it didn't. To rerun recovery against staging you'll need the vault passphrase, which is appended just below.

recovery phrase for yafof-tajof: julmir-kelax-julvan-holath-belvan-holir-ralael-ralvan-ralath-julvan-silmir-istmir-kaswyn-ulamir

## Formula sandbox tuning

User-supplied formulas in Gridmoor execute inside a restricted interpreter with hard ceilings on time, memory, and call depth. Reviewers should confirm any change to these ceilings is justified in the PR description, since raising them widens the abuse surface. Defaults were chosen from production traces. The current limits are as follows.

limits module of tafog-fawip:
WEIGHTS = {
    "julix": 57,
    "lamys": 992,
    "kasvan": 209,
    "quenok": 750,
    "alddor": 259,
    "oliath": 1009,
    "wenix": 815,
}

**Bike cage and parking gates.** On your first morning at Fenwright Hall, cycle parking is in the covered cage behind Block C; the vehicle gates on Marsh Lane open automatically for registered plates, so send yours to the facilities inbox beforehand. The pedestrian gate beside the cage stays locked around the clock. Until your permanent badge is programmed, open the cage and gate using the code below.

staff pass of kawip-hawef = bdg-QLP-2